Senior Mechanical Engineer

4 months ago


Edmonton, Canada Englobe Full time

Your Employer

Dare to join Englobe

At nearly 3,000 people, Englobe is one of Canada's premier firms specializing in professional engineering services, environmental sciences, and soil and biomass treatment.

With offices located across Canada, the United Kingdom and France, we are conveniently located to support large- and small-scale projects, through different stages, in many sectors. Offering a range of value-added services that run the gamut from professional consulting services to turnkey project implementation, Englobe has developed a reputation for integrity, credibility, and people-centered values.

Englobe (Formerly Arrow Engineering) is looking for a Senior Mechanical Engineer to work out of the Edmonton office.

As a member of the Mechanical Engineering division, the Senior Mechanical Engineer has shared responsibility for the performance and success of our mechanical engineering team, and firm, respectively. This position will report directly to the Director, work independently, and with minimal supervision, while working in collaboration with various colleagues and external partners. The incumbent will actively pursue and influence the development of new business while offering leadership to a professional team.

Working on various mechanical engineering project types which include (mechanical engineering for buildings such as municipal, healthcare, recreation, multifamily, commercial retail, assemblies, labs, military, and policing to name a few). The work environment is of high volume, offering a range of project complexities and requires a high level of responsibility.

Your Contribution

  • Provide leadership and mentorship to the various team members.
  • Experience with designing cooling and heating ventilation systems, HVAC design, design plumbing systems for sewage and potable water, design fire extinguishing systems for different building types.
  • Utltimately responsible for ensuring the mechanical drawings and specifications meet established project criteria and applicable standards.
  • Project management tasks as required, including responsibility for internal project financial budgets, coordination of project personnel resources, timely submission of deliverables, and monitoring project scope.
  • Coordinate the preparation of engineering specifications and drawings, quantity, and opinions on probability of cost.
  • Preparation of reports, proposals, and tender/bid submissions, budgets, project plans, and other supporting documentation, as required.
  • Attend project meetings with Clients and other design team members.
  • Coordinate with other design disciplines within Englobe and externally.
  • Participate in internal and external project meetings.
  • Carry out and assist with field reviews.
  • Communicating with clients, contractors, and suppliers in the positive promotion of the firm.
  • Meet with clients regarding projects, progress reporting, and the resolution of issues, as required.
  • Apply and promote Englobe's health and safety rules.

Your Profile

  • Degree in Mechanical Engineering from an accredited University.
  • Eligible for membership with APEGA.
  • P.Eng. or in the process of obtaining P.Eng.
  • 10 years of related industry experience.
  • Excellent verbal communication and technical writing skills.
  • Show an aptitude of general construction methods, problem solving and troubleshooting.
  • Valid driver's license (job duties may include some travel).
  • Ability to work effectively independently and within a team environment.
  • Self-motivated with a strong work ethic.
  • Effectively manages a variety of projects and/or initiatives, often occurring simultaneously.
  • Leadership ability.
  • Sense of humour.
  • Enjoys working in a professional office environment, with occasional client and/or site visits, and can work outside of normal business hours, when necessary.
